About this conversion

Sievert and Milligray are units used in the radiation family of measurements. Sievert measures equivalent radiation dose (biological risk-weighted dose), while Milligray measures absorbed radiation dose (energy deposited per unit mass). This page provides the direct numeric ratio between the two units. This converter uses the precise relationship 1 Sievert = 1000 Milligrays (equivalently 1 Milligray = 0.001 Sieverts), so results stay accurate for nuclear medicine, radiation safety, health physics, and scientific research.
